Abstract

The invention relates to a 3.5KV high-voltage trolley pushed by hand to move, particularly provides an auxiliary tool used for enabling an armour-type high-voltage switch to be transferred into a high-voltage switch cabinet, and belongs to the technical field of electric equipment. The high-voltage trolley pushed by hand to move comprises two handcart machine frames symmetrically arranged in a bilateral mode, wherein stand columns are fixed to the two handcart machine frames respectively, the upper end of each stand column is connected with a transmission mechanism support, and a transmission mechanism is arranged on each transmission mechanism support. A connecting rod connected to one end of each transmission mechanism drives a transmission lead screw connected to the other end of the transmission mechanism. A lead screw nut is connected to each transmission lead screw in a screwed mode, the lead screw nuts are fixed to a lifting guide plate, a plurality of lifting guide wheels are arranged on a side face of the lifting guide plate, and the plurality of lifting guide wheels are arranged in lifting guide rails. The high-voltage trolley pushed by hand to move is easy in transmission and accurate in positioning, the high-voltage trolley pushed by hand to move is pushed by hand to move so that the operation is convenient and easy to conduct, and the high-voltage trolley pushed by hand to move can not incline or be damaged in the moving process due to bolt positioning and design of the guide rails.
